Specs:
  • 16" 3840x2400 400-nits OLED Display, 100% DCI-P3, HDR500
  • Ryzen 7 Pro 7840U 8C/16T 3.3 GHz (5.1 GHz Boost, 24MB cache)
  • Radeon 780M Integrated Graphics
  • 32GB LPDDR5X 6400 MHz Ram
  • 1TB M.2 2280 PCIe Gen4 TLC Performance SSD Opal
  • Backlit Keyboard
  • Fingerprint Reader
  • 5MP IR+RGB Webcam /w Windows Hello, Privacy Shutter
  • Qualcomm NFA-725A 802.11AX (2 x 2) + Bluetooth 5.1
  • Windows 11 Pro
  • Ports:
    • 2x USB-A 3.2 Gen 1 (5Gbps) (1 x always on)
    • 1x USB-C 3.2 Gen 2 (10Gbps)
    • USB-C 4.0 40 Gbps (Data, DisplayPort 1.4, Power Delivery)
    • 1x HDMI 2.1
    • 1x Audio Combo Jack
    • 1x RJ-45 Gigabit Ethernet
  • Integrated Li-Polymer 86Wh battery
  • 3.76 lbs

Looks like with ID Me, you can get down to $1,139 before tax. Out the door with 12% CB & taxes, can get it for around ~$1,100. Not bad for a 4k screen!
You'd definitely want the larger battery - if it's the same model as last year's Gen 1, then you can buy the larger battery (5B10W51872) through laptop battery shop for ~$63 (was $100 last year!).
Unsure if it's the same battery size, but this looks like a similar chassis as gen 1...

I'm satisfied with gen 1 (not insanely overjoyed with it, but it's a good work machine and I can't complain!), so am going to wait for a while.

For last year's model, the larger battery took me from ~5 hr battery life to ~8 hr battery life on "Better Performance" mode. Not sure you'll see that here, but would love to read reports from you if you buy this and try the bigger battery!
